Match Centre: Hull City relegated but York City head for Wembley
Hull were all-but down, but today's 2-2 draw at Wigan confirmed the Tigers will be playing Championship football next season.
Steve Gohouri scored an injury-time equaliser for Wigan after Victor Moses fired the Latics ahead.

York took a 1-0 lead to Luton Town with the Minstermen 90 minutes from Wembley. And they secured the trip with a 1-0 win at the Hatters thanks to a strike from Chris Carruthers.
Carruthers's moment came when he poked in a rebound after Luton keeper Mark Tyler could only parry Michael Rankine's sweetly-struck free kick.
